Cartoon Network is rebooting the animated "Teen Titans" series and the theme song by Puffy is getting a bit of a face lift via a remix by DJ Mix Master Mike. He is well known for his work with the Beastie Boys in-particular.
Anything that keeps a lifeline from Japan to the US in regards to Puffy is a good thing, but my view on re-mixes is not a secret either.

Datsu Dystopia Full PV
Here is the now full video for the new Datsu Dystopia video. We had gotten a snippet of the song for the HIS advert a while back and I liked what I heard. I am not entirely sure after an extended listen what I think. Datsu Dystopia reminds me of the on of the songs on "Bring it!" penned by Shiina Ringo, specifically Hiyori Hime). Is it a good song for the composer, but I am not sold on it being a good song by Puffy.
So far as the video goes I have a couple of random thoughts. Yumi's hair was redone between parts of Datsu Dystopia so the shaved side of her head and blonde tones are only in the travel agent set. It makes for an interesting contrast and puts some distance between the scenes. Secondly the Travel Agent scenes seem very thrown together, which kinda works. To me it feels like a call back to a cheesy 80's music video, which I thought was fun(or that the budget from HIS was not huge).
Overall I think I find myself wanting something different than what Datsu Dystopia is offering. I wanted more of an "uh oh here comes Puffy" type song as a lead off from their (well deserved) hiatus. Not to sound too negative, I am keeping an open mind on this. There are songs that did grow on me over time like Ai No Shirushi or Hiyori Hime.

Puffy Is Back
The new single "Datsu Dystopia" is set for a May 22 release and was produced by LOW IQ 01 (who covered "MOTHER" on the Puffy Covers album.*
Here is a snippet which is mostly in the background, but I like what I can hear.
Were I to make a guess, I'd suspect a new album is on the horizon, whether that means summer or fall is a bigger question. For now a single is most welcome news.
